VOLUNTEER WORK: FVU recreation soccer coach for 1st-2nd grade boys. Helped start the Flathead Valley’s first low barrier homeless shelter. I have been an active member of the Board of Directors since we began in 2018- present. The mission of the Flathead Warming Center is to save lives, link resources, and encourage dignity through low-barrier access to a warm safe place for those in need. We provide seasonal, low barrier access to night shelter services regardless of an individual or family’s personal barriers to housing security. We provide showers, laundry, light food, and onsite resources throughout the year.
